* [morty][PATCH 1/2] selftest/signing: add --batch to gpg invocation when importing keys

Otherwise it may pop up windows asking for passphrases which breaks
automated testing.

Newer YP releases and master already have the fix.

diff --git a/meta/lib/oeqa/selftest/signing.py b/meta/lib/oeqa/selftest/signing.py
index 3b5c2da0e0f..02e5f5ad29d 100644
--- a/meta/lib/oeqa/selftest/signing.py
+++ b/meta/lib/oeqa/selftest/signing.py
@@ -26,7 +26,7 @@ class Signing(oeSelfTest):
         cls.pub_key_path = os.path.join(cls.testlayer_path, 'files', 'signing', "key.pub")
         cls.secret_key_path = os.path.join(cls.testlayer_path, 'files', 'signing', "key.secret")
 
-        runCmd('gpg --homedir %s --import %s %s' % (cls.gpg_dir, cls.pub_key_path, cls.secret_key_path))
+        runCmd('gpg --batch --homedir %s --import %s %s' % (cls.gpg_dir, cls.pub_key_path, cls.secret_key_path))

* [morty][PATCH 2/2] qemu: fix memfd_create with glibc 2.27

glibc 2.27 has added memfd_create() but this conflicts with a copy in qemu, so
take a patch from upstream to fix building with glibc 2.27.

+Subject: [PATCH] memfd: fix configure test

+Recent glibc added memfd_create in sys/mman.h.  This conflicts with
+the definition in util/memfd.c:
+
+    /builddir/build/BUILD/qemu-2.11.0-rc1/util/memfd.c:40:12: error: static declaration of memfd_create follows non-static declaration
+
+Fix the configure test, and remove the sys/memfd.h inclusion since the
+file actually does not exist---it is a typo in the memfd_create(2) man
+page.

+diff --git a/configure b/configure
+index 9c8aa5a98b..99ccc1725a 100755
+--- a/configure
++++ b/configure
+@@ -3923,7 +3923,7 @@ fi
+ # check if memfd is supported
+ memfd=no
+ cat > $TMPC << EOF
+-#include <sys/memfd.h>
++#include <sys/mman.h>
+ 
+ int main(void)
+ {
+diff --git a/util/memfd.c b/util/memfd.c
+index 4571d1aba8..412e94a405 100644
+--- a/util/memfd.c
++++ b/util/memfd.c
+@@ -31,9 +31,7 @@
+ 
+ #include "qemu/memfd.h"
+ 
+-#ifdef CONFIG_MEMFD
+-#include <sys/memfd.h>
+-#elif defined CONFIG_LINUX
++#if defined CONFIG_LINUX && !defined CONFIG_MEMFD
+ #include <sys/syscall.h>
+ #include <asm/unistd.h>
+
